Subject: [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H] avcodec/mediacodecdec: add low-latency decoding
Date: Mon, 22 May 2023 17:56:31 +0800
Message-ID: <tencent_3E66CFE6752F7B088D66C3C4B4339E80FB0A@qq.com> (raw)

The low-latency decoding mode has available in Android api 30.
It will keep less buffer internally, and output frame as fast as possible.
See https://developer.android.google.cn/reference/android/media/MediaCodec?hl=en#PARAMETER_KEY_LOW_LATENCY

Signed-off-by: xufuji456 <839789740@qq.com>
---
 libavcodec/mediacodecdec.c | 4 ++++
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+)

diff --git a/libavcodec/mediacodecdec.c b/libavcodec/mediacodecdec.c
index 21464900d1..5fece6ee5b 100644
--- a/libavcodec/mediacodecdec.c
+++ b/libavcodec/mediacodecdec.c
@@ -394,6 +394,10 @@ static av_cold int mediacodec_decode_init(AVCodecContext *avctx)
     ff_AMediaFormat_setString(format, "mime", codec_mime);
     ff_AMediaFormat_setInt32(format, "width", avctx->width);
     ff_AMediaFormat_setInt32(format, "height", avctx->height);
+    // low-latency mode: available in Android api 30
+    if (avctx->flags & AV_CODEC_FLAG_LOW_DELAY) {
+        ff_AMediaFormat_setInt32(format, "low-latency", 1);
+    }
 
     s->ctx = av_mallocz(sizeof(*s->ctx));
     if (!s->ctx) {
